SM&A; Corp., a Newport Beach aerospace and defense management services company, said Wednesday that it has acquired an Alexandria, Va., simulation software maker.
The price paid for System Simulation Systems Inc. was not disclosed, but SM&A; said in a press release that it consisted of cash, a promissory note and a two-year earn-out, contingent upon the achievement of certain operating results.
System Simulation’s revenue last year was more than $7.5 million. SM&A; reported sales of $79.4 million for the first nine months.
